(a) The Board may issue a refillable container permit for draft beer to a holder of a Class B or Class D license. (b) Before the Board issues the permit to an applicant, the applicant shall: (1) complete the form that the Board provides; and (2) pay an annual permit fee of $500. (c) The hours of sale for the permit: (1) begin at the same time as those for the underlying license; and (2) end at midnight. (d) Receipts collected under the permit shall be included in the calculation of average daily receipts from the sale of alcoholic beverages under a Class B restaurant license and a Class B hotel license.
